How does infection occur?

Factors that provoke the disease include cuts, wounds, abrasions on the legs, and damage caused by wearing tight shoes. Insufficient foot care, especially with excessive sweating, as well as taking antibiotics and decreased immunity contribute to the appearance of mycoses.

Infection is possible through contact with a sick person, using someone else's shoes, washcloths, or a room rug.

Therefore, the greatest chance of catching a fungus exists when one of the family members suffers from this disease. Flakes of the skin of a person infected with a fungus can fly out into the surrounding space, infecting another.

This often happens in crowded places in high humidity conditions - in a bathhouse, sauna, swimming pool. Fungal infection can occur even in salons providing manicure and pedicure services, where sanitary standards are not sufficiently monitored. Adults are more often susceptible to the disease, but sometimes a child’s leg can also suffer from the fungus.

Symptoms of the disease

The manifestation of mycosis begins with increased dryness and flaking on the heels and feet. Sometimes redness is observed, accompanied by severe itching, the formation of blisters and corns. People who suffer from excessive sweating experience diaper rash. The nail changes its structure and color, becoming yellow and cracking. When spores penetrate deeply into the plate, voids are formed underneath it, filled with a crumbling mixture, and an unpleasant putrefactive odor occurs.

In its advanced stage, toenail fungus makes walking difficult and can cause fever. In such cases, you should immediately contact a dermatologist. Complications associated with mycosis can manifest themselves in the form of psoriasis and eczema.

There are three types of fungal infection of the toenails, the symptoms of which differ:

  • Vesicular. In this case, the lower part of the foot suffers, on which small blisters filled with liquid form.
  • Membrane. It appears between the toes in the form of cracks.
  • Moccasin type. Thickening of the skin with the formation of cracks appears on the heels and soles. By capturing the nails, the fungal pathogen causes disruption of their structure. The body may react with an allergy.

    How does onychomycosis develop?

    Foot fungus affects the skin and nails quite slowly - a person may not even notice the onset of the disease. Even if you do not have onychomycosis, you should regularly inspect your feet while trimming your nails for signs of infection. Here are some symptoms and changes that should alert you.

  • Color. As a rule, infection begins with a change in the color of the nail plate. Most often, the big toe is the first to become infected. The nail may become gray or yellow and cloudy. In some cases, the nail becomes so thin that blood capillaries can be seen through it. With serious infections, the nail turns brown and even black.
  • The structure of the nail also changes. It thickens, moves away from the skin, and the gap under the nail plate increases. In many cases, the plate affected by the fungus begins to crumble and collapse. Over time, the nail dies and becomes literally keratinized.
  • Leather. The fungus thrives not only on nails, but also on the skin. Initially, damage to the epidermis is manifested by itching and burning, especially when wearing shoes. Then the skin begins to crack, becomes dry and painful, and peeling appears.
  • If the feet are seriously damaged, a person may develop local hyperthermia, the patient cannot wear usual shoes due to pain and discomfort, and an unpleasant odor emanates from the skin and nails. If a person has been sick for more than one year, his immunity decreases, he often suffers from colds, and allergic reactions become more obvious.

    Where does foot fungus come from?

    Infection with the fungus occurs through contact with infected tissue particles. Pieces of the epidermis or nail, falling on the skin of a healthy person, develop under favorable conditions - humidity and high temperature. But where and how can a person become infected with onychomycosis?

    1. Most often, people become infected with the fungus from relatives and friends with a similar diagnosis. In this case, infection occurs through common household items - slippers, washcloths, socks, towels, bathtubs, and even the floor if a sick person walks on it barefoot.
    2. Very often, infection occurs where high humidity is combined with bare feet. These are swimming pools, saunas and baths, gyms' changing rooms, public showers, etc.
    3. Fungus is a very resistant microorganism that does not die even at high and low temperatures. This means that you can get nail fungus even on the beach if you like to walk barefoot on the sand.
    4. In some cases, you can become infected with fungus through pedicure tools and accessories if they have not been properly disinfected.
    5. It is important to understand that the fungus, when it gets on the skin of a healthy person, does not attach to everyone. A healthy immune system can fight off pathogens. The risk of infection increases if the patient is weakened after illness, if he has additional chronic diseases, takes antibiotics or oral contraceptives, etc.
    6. If the skin on a person’s legs peels, if there are wounds and abrasions, the likelihood of infection increases many times, since the fungus immediately gets inside the wound, bypassing the protective skin barrier. People with sweaty feet are also at risk - fungi multiply much faster on damp skin. But what to do if insidious microorganisms have already affected the skin and nails?

      Drug treatment of onychomycosis

      In general, treating nail fungus is a very long and labor-intensive process that must be approached with full responsibility. Only with regular and comprehensive therapy can real results be achieved. The duration of treatment is associated with complete damage to the nail plate. That is, until the diseased nail is completely replaced by a healthy one, there can be no talk of a final recovery. And the rate of nail growth is different for everyone; sometimes the time to completely change the plate can take up to 4-6 months. But how to achieve this restoration? In the fight against nail fungus, various forms of medications are used, which we will talk about in more detail.

      1. Drops. Before using the medicine, the nails must be prepared. The nail plate should be cut off as much as possible at the root, and the upper keratinized part should be ground off with a file. This is done to ensure that the medicinal liquid penetrates the affected tissue as deeply as possible. After this, you need to thoroughly rinse and dry your feet and drop the medicine not only on the nails, but also on the affected skin around it. Carefully process the side edge of the nail - in the fold with the skin. The drops should be used twice a day until the nail is completely replaced.
      2. Ointments, gels, creams. This dosage form is very convenient for treating not only the nail plate itself, but also the skin around it. The convenient form of the medicine perfectly relieves itching and burning on the skin, suppressing unpleasant symptoms almost immediately. Before applying the cream or gel, the skin must be thoroughly washed and dried. Apply the drug to the skin and nails, rub into the nail plate and epidermis for at least three minutes. Use the cream every day until the nail and skin are completely restored.
      3. Sprays. This dosage form is easy to use. A spray is a liquid form of medication that quickly penetrates the skin structure and instantly relieves the symptoms of burning and itching. However, it is important to understand that the spray is, most often, preventative care. It can be used after visiting public places - swimming pools and locker rooms, where the risk of contracting onychomycosis is high.
      4. Varnish. This is the most convenient dosage form to use and is becoming increasingly popular. Before applying medicinal varnish, the feet should be washed and dried, the nail plate should be cleaned as much as possible from parts affected by the fungus - both along the length and thickness of the nail. Before applying varnish, the nail should be degreased with any alcohol composition. Next, medicinal varnish is generously applied in one layer. When it dries, you can apply decorative varnish on top of it - this does not impair the effectiveness of the treatment. Some medicinal varnishes already have a tint color. This allows women not only to receive treatment, but also to hide their defect at the same time. Medicinal varnishes should be applied every other day, especially at the initial stage of treatment. The previous layer of medicine must be removed with a special composition. As the condition of the nail improves, the interval between applications can be increased.
      5. Preparations for oral use. For serious lesions of onychomycosis, in addition to local treatment, drugs are prescribed to suppress the fungus from the inside. Such products must be used simultaneously with local treatment. It is very important to choose the right dosage and regimen for taking the medication. Medicines against nail fungus treat already affected tissues and prevent the spread of the disease. But for this they need to be taken for several months. Remember, antifungal medications may cause some side effects, so you should only take them after consulting your doctor. The most popular means for treating fungus from the inside are Fluconazole, Irunin, Diflucan, Fucis, Lamisil, Terbizil, Rumicosis, etc.
